The beneficial effects of the utility model are:
1st, this utility model passes through a thrust bearing with dust cover structure, and this utility model is tied by inclined plane
The bearing housing of structure and bearing inside casing increased the contact point of roller, improve stability, dust cover instead of tradition simultaneously
Rubber system dust ring, dust cover is applied not only to be connected with rotating machinery, simultaneously outside dust cover and roller contact, with bearing
Constitute the supporting construction of a triangle between frame, bearing inside casing, improve stability, reduce local location and pressed through
High so that the problem that is easily damaged of bearing.
2nd, screw connecting structure makes the roller of this bearing, bearing inside casing become prone to dismantle and safeguard so that by bearing
Roller be conveniently replaceable, and bearing inside casing and housing can voluntarily pincers worker reparation, reduce cost.
3rd, ash stop plate expands the area of dust cover, improves the cleanliness factor of bearing.
4th, auxiliary roller reduces the frictional force between support baseboard and bearing inside casing, improves the life-span.
5th, support ring further increases the strong point of roller, has shared bearing inside casing and the pressure of bearing housing, improves
Life-span.

In this configuration, bearing roller includes four supporting surfaces, and is fixedly connected two-by-two between four supporting surfaces, compares
For two supporting surfaces of traditional bearing, stability greatly improves, and the trapezoidal supporting and space of two inclined-plane compositions is compared simultaneously
In the supporting and space of traditional bearing rectangle, its thrust performance more preferably, will not lead to the stuck of bearing because extruding force is excessive;
This bearing removal also relatively simple it is only necessary to unclamp the screw between retainer ring and connection ring it is possible to open
The self-locking structure of roller, it is possible to first take out extruding cover plate, further takes out roller, finally realize bearing inside casing and bearing housing point
From;
During installation, this bearing by screw, support baseboard can be fixed on base, by the retainer ring on ring baffle
It is integrally connected on the chassis of rotator by screw, more convenient compared to static pressure connection disassembling and installation.
